How we work
Most engagements begin with a short scoping study: what is being measured, what the number will be used to decide, and whether the current method can support that decision. Reports are written to be read by both the engineering team and the customer receiving the part.
We do not sell instruments and hold no distribution agreements, so recommendations carry no supplier interest.
